When uploading a CSV file in Revlitix, you’ll need to map each column to a corresponding data type. Choosing the correct type ensures accurate reporting and data analysis.
Below are the data types for CSV Integration, and when you can use them:
a. Integer
Use when: The column contains positive or negative numeric values.
Examples: 1, 5, 100, -2
Use cases: Number of Clicks, Page Views
b. Decimal
Use when: The column contains numbers with decimal points.
Examples: 2.5, 99.99, 0.75, -3.75
Use cases: Conversion Rate, Cost per Click
c. String
Use when: The column contains text values.
Examples: Campaign Name, Facebook Ads, March Launch
Use cases: Campaign Type, Platform Name
d. Boolean
Use when: The column contains true/false values.
Examples: true, false
Use cases: Is Campaign Active?, Is Converted?
Note: Values must be lowercase string versions: true or false.
e. Date
Use when: The column contains date values.
Supported formats:
dd/MM/yyyy → 24/04/2025
dd-MM-yyyy → 24-04-2025
MM/dd/yyyy → 04/24/2025
MM-dd-yyyy → 04-24-2025
yyyy/MM/dd → 2025/04/24
yyyy-MM-dd → 2025-04-24
Use cases: Campaign Start Date, Reported On
Make sure all entries in the column follow the same date format.
f. Duration
Use when: The column contains time durations.
Supported formats:
Seconds: 120, 3600, 45
HH:MM:SS: 00:02:00, 01:30:15, 00:00:45
Use cases: Time Spent on Page, Average Session Duration
Only use this data type if all values match one of the above formats.